Your data plane. Your choice.

Two deployment models, one platform. The choice is where your data lives, not which Panther you get.

CONNECTED

Bring your own cloud or data lake. Panther runs inside your AWS account, against your Snowflake or Databricks. Your security data stays in your warehouse, and the detection engine, workflows, and agents operate against it in place.

HOSTED

Panther operates a managed cloud. Fully managed by Panther, with your data ingested into a dedicated, isolated environment. The fastest path to value when there's no internal data warehouse mandate or when single-vendor operations matter most.

Frequently asked questions

What is Panther?

Panther is an AI SOC platform. It ingests and normalizes logs at petabyte scale, lets your team write detection rules in Python or automatically creates detections using AI / natural language, and surfaces threats in real time, without the infrastructure burden or unpredictable costs of legacy platforms.

Do we need a dedicated detection engineering team to use Panther?

No. Teams with detection engineers get the full power of Detection-as-Code — Python rules, version control, CI/CD workflows. Teams without them can start with Panther's built-in detection library and AI Detection Builder, then grow into custom rules over time.

Can Panther replace our existing SIEM / SOC?

Yes and many customers migrate from Splunk, Sumo Logic, or Elastic. Panther is particularly well-suited for AWS-heavy environments and teams who want to treat detections like software.

How does Panther handle data retention and compliance?

Panther uses a security data lake architecture, giving you flexible, cost-effective long-term retention. You own your data and can query it at any time. Retention policies are configurable to meet compliance requirements.

What integrations does Panther support?

Panther connects to cloud platforms (AWS, GCP, Azure), SaaS tools, endpoints, and network devices. Alerts route to Slack, Jira, PagerDuty, and more. For orchestration and response, Panther provides agentic workflows and runbooks or integrates with external SOAR platforms.

How long does it take to deploy?

Most teams are ingesting logs and running detections within days, not months. The main work is integrations, data validation, and tuning, not infrastructure setup.
